Hello,

I tried FIRS 2 and it looks great, but there are too many industry -possibilities according to my liking. Can't really tell where to begin.
So, I started a more simple game with Dutch Trainset 2, and though the graphics are great, I hardly use the wagons because of their lack in travel speed. I use the wagons of OpenGFX +Trains. That way I can transport cargo more quickly.

I don't begin about the why of the wagon -speed in Dutch Trainset 2, I just wish they could travel faster, to be more competitive with other wagon sets. Is there a way around? I just checked the parameters but they don't change speed...

Re: Graphics Fan (Dutch Trainset 2), with question.

Post by Transportman »

You can disable the wagon speed limits if you want. It's an option in the Advanced Settings of OpenTTD.

Re: Graphics Fan (Dutch Trainset 2), with question.

Post by kamnet »

As for the why, if I remember reading correctly, the set was coded to reflect the reality of rail travel in the Netherlands. The wagons don't go faster because legally they're not allowed to.

Also, as for FIRS 2, try using one of the "Basic" economies rather than "Extreme". In FIRS 3 I believe that "Temperate Basic" will be the new default economy, but it will also now have six economies to choose from.
